Transaction 716707076c37648c93aedd5561e6e477f403ede736fc177749a5cacf99ea600d

1 Input
2 Outputs
  • 716707076c37648c93aedd5561e6e477f403ede736fc177749a5cacf99ea600d:0
  • value  335479
    address  17iKc6oNDHjFhQb2Z8FK5vWuCgZYmFedXV
  • 716707076c37648c93aedd5561e6e477f403ede736fc177749a5cacf99ea600d:1
  • value  2522136
    address  3DB6xURTAXHW4QHArvuFkoEAxeZygHMEqt